Research indicates that rosemary oil may be as effective in reducing hair loss and promoting hair growth as 2% minoxidil (such as Rogaine). You can apply rosemary oil for hair growth by massaging it directly onto your scalp or by adding it to your shampoo.

There is no controlled data showing the efficacy of this product as an addition to specific treatments for hair loss conditions. A 2023 study found that participants given this supplement had a better response to hair treatments than those who received the treatments alone, but the study had several limitations. The study was not double-blind (double-blind means that neither the participants nor the researchers know which treatment the individual participants are receiving).

Trimming your hair every few months may boost the growth of healthy hair. It removes split ends, preventing them from spreading farther up your strands and causing hair breakage.
